Cement Grinding - Cement Plant Optimization

Water Spray in Cement Mills. Water spray installed generally in second compartment of ball mill to control cement temperature. Cement discharge temperature should be kept below about 110 o C but, the same time should allow some 60% dehydration of gypsum to

Energy consideration in cement grinding

2011-12-6  Detrimental effects of feed moisture on energy consumption o Typically, every 1% increase in moisture content above 0.5% increases energy consumption by >10%, especially at higher product fineness o At limiting moisture, eg. above ~ 5% in limestone, a ball mill may not be operable! Cement grinding in wet production method -

2021-4-16  The clinker is comminuted with gypsum, hydraulic and other additives. The joint grinding ensures thorough mixing of all materials, and high uniformity of cement is one of important guarantees of its quality. Hydraulic additives, being highly porous materials, are generally high-moisture materials (up to 20–30% and more).
